在SAP财务模块的复杂生态中,利润中心会计(EC-PCA)扮演着连接管理会计与组织架构的关键角色。当财务IT团队面对系统优化需求时,1KEF配置节点中的"联机转账"与"行项目"两个标识往往成为决策的十字路口——这不仅关系到月结效率,更直接影响数据追溯能力和系统响应速度。本文将拆解这两个配置参数的技术本质,通过真实业务场景对比分析,帮助您做出符合企业特性的架构决策。
联机转账(Online Transfer)标识的勾选,决定了财务数据流向利润中心模块的传输机制。启用后,任何原始凭证过账都会实时触发利润中心凭证的生成,形成所谓的"热链路"集成模式。
在SAP底层架构中,联机转账通过事件驱动模型运作:
ABAP复制* 简化版的凭证过账事件处理逻辑
FORM post_document USING document_header TYPE bkpf.
IF sy-tcode = 'FB01' OR sy-tcode = 'F-02'. "财务凭证过账事务码
PERFORM create_pca_document USING document_header. "触发利润中心凭证创建
ENDIF.
ENDFORM.
这种实时处理机制依赖于SAP的更新任务(Update Task)体系,将利润中心凭证生成作为主凭证过账的后续操作。
优势矩阵:
| 维度 | 联机转账(启用) | 联机转账(禁用) |
|---|---|---|
| 数据时效性 | 实时可见 | 需要手动执行FAGLL03/FM界面传输 |
| 月结压力 | 日常均匀分布 | 月末集中处理 |
| 系统负载 | 日常交易响应时间增加5-15% | 月末批量作业可能超时 |
| 错误处理 | 即时发现过账错误 | 月末才发现配置问题 |
实际案例:某快消企业启用联机转账后,月结时间从72小时缩短至28小时,但日常财务关账操作响应时间从1.2秒延长至1.8秒。
关键决策点:当企业存在高频利润中心分析需求(如每日事业部报表)时,联机转账的价值大于性能代价;若仅需月度管理报告,则批量传输可能更优。
行项目(Line Item)标识控制着利润中心会计是否保留原始交易的明细记录,这本质上是存储成本与审计能力的权衡。
启用行项目时,系统会在表CEPC00中为每笔交易创建独立记录;禁用时仅更新汇总表CEPC01中的余额数据。两种模式的存储差异显著:
sql复制-- 行项目模式下的典型查询(可追溯原始凭证)
SELECT * FROM CEPC00
WHERE PRCTR = 'P100'
AND BUDAT BETWEEN '20230101' AND '20230131';
-- 汇总模式下的替代方案(需关联其他模块)
SELECT * FROM CEPC01
LEFT JOIN BKPF ON...
WHERE PRCTR = 'P100'
AND MONAT = '01';
在某制造企业的压力测试中(S/4HANA 2022环境):
| 数据量 | 行项目启用 | 行项目禁用 |
|---|---|---|
| 10万笔交易 | 存储占用4.2GB | 存储占用0.8GB |
| 利润中心报表响应 | 2.4秒 | 0.7秒 |
| 年度数据追溯 | 完整原始凭证 | 需调用FAGLL03重构 |
经验法则:当存在以下需求时建议启用行项目:① 内部转移定价审计 ② 利润中心间对账 ③ 频繁的明细查询。纯汇总报告场景可考虑禁用。
联机转账与行项目的四种组合方式,对应不同的业务场景:
适用情况:
配置示例:
code复制[1KEF配置]
联机转账标识:X
行项目标识:X
性能优化建议:
CREATE INDEX ZIDX_CEPC00_PR ON CEPC00(PRCTR,RBUKRS,BELNR)适用情况:
风险缓解方案:
ABAP复制* 月末执行手动传输的检查程序
REPORT ZPCA_CHECK.
DATA lt_errors TYPE TABLE OF bapiret2.
CALL FUNCTION 'FAGL_PCA_TRANSFER'
EXPORTING
iv_test_run = abap_true
IMPORTING
et_messages = lt_errors.
此模式需建立传输异常监控机制,建议通过作业调度定期检查未传输凭证。
即使做出合理配置选择,实际运行中仍可能遇到性能瓶颈。以下是经过验证的优化手段:
对于启用行项目的大型企业,按利润中心+会计年度分区可提升查询效率:
sql复制-- HANA数据库的分区方案
ALTER TABLE CEPC00 PARTITION BY HASH (PRCTR, GJAHR)
PARTITIONS 32;
错误码PCA-047:通常表示利润中心主数据缺失,检查:
传输中断处理:
在全球化部署案例中,某汽车集团通过联机转账+行项目的基础配置,配合HANA内存计算特性,实现了2000+利润中心的实时合并报表,关键是在测试环境充分验证了不同业务场景下的系统表现。